Question
How would Wolfire feel about me writing a story, (maybe even a full novel), based off the world of Receiver? I would develop the world more, take suggestions from the community, and publish it as an eBook on multiple platforms. It would make the game slightly more popular and perhaps inspire a mod for the game. I know David has a lot on his plate right now, so I probably wouldn't be able to contact him about this.

Characters
Unnamed Main Character

Unnamed Character (leads main around until Mind-Kill)

Unnamed Receiver

Unnamed Transmitter

Setting
Futuristic metropolitan area (Reality B, consists of our physical world)

Reality A (consists of mankind in sleep state, transmitters [inhumane beings with dreaming capabilities], the Threat [similar inhumane beings with better technology and terrible morality issues])

Story
Set before the events of the Mind-Kill in third-person. Transmitters are dreaming in the dead drops of tapes and firepower while the Threat is preparing the Mind-Kill. Mankind is going about it's business and living. The tapes are beginning to be discovered. The Threat sees this and through it's mind tech, brainwashes most of mankind to ignore the tapes. The individuals who find the tapes listen to them and continue listening to them again and again, swearing they hear singing. The Threat already had a backup plan for the Mind-Kill; the kill-drones. The Mind-Kill occurs and the Threat dreams in it's kill-drones. Those who consciousnesses were cut off fall into oblivion and their bodies disappear. Those who survive lose their memory. The Transmitters prepared for this, as they set their tapes to brainwash their soldiers, the Receivers, anyways. Those who achieve Awake will appear in Reality A with an actual body instead of a bodiless consciousness. The Main Character goes through all of this. Obviously.

What do you think?
